Output 93a14c592dbf99031080b42174af46e40ca1747de6fc6dbef89f620b6180dea9:0

value
301383
script pubkey
OP_0 OP_PUSHBYTES_20 fcb99c8c21bd1d6909b9050f1c461f85a7a971f6
address
bc1qljueerpph5wkjzdeq583c3slskn6ju0kgnyp2w
transaction
93a14c592dbf99031080b42174af46e40ca1747de6fc6dbef89f620b6180dea9
confirmations
132060
spent
true